Transaction 21afbc95241b3d0cba35716a375b2ccb54f830fc12fd410659cee41eecf0054a

1 Input
2 Outputs
  • 21afbc95241b3d0cba35716a375b2ccb54f830fc12fd410659cee41eecf0054a:0
  • value  126000
    address  32FGsjkv3v5vj3WQ8R7qvjXNVvSxoVDz5W
  • 21afbc95241b3d0cba35716a375b2ccb54f830fc12fd410659cee41eecf0054a:1
  • value  40499163
    address  33mPnQHeWeh1bQy3KJgboWvHAWiB4xCTws